The Secureye Biometric SDK is a collection of development tools, libraries, documentation, and sample code designed to bridge the gap between Secureye hardware scanners and custom software platforms. Instead of building biometric image processing, mathematical template generation, and matching algorithms from scratch, developers can use this pre-built, optimized framework.
